Going Clear: Scientology & the Prison of Belief is a documentary directed by Alex Gibney in 2015 and based on the book Going Clear: Scientology, Hollywood, and the Prison of Belief by Lawrence Wright, first published in 2013. The documentary features Jason Beghe, Paul Haggis, Tom Cruise, John Travolta, Nazanin Boniadi, and others.

Storyline
Going Clear is based closely on Lawrence Wright’s book, covering much of the same ground with the aid of archive footage, dramatic reconstructions, and interviews with eight former Scientologists: Paul Haggis, Mark Rathbun, Mike Rinder, actor Jason Beghe, Sylvia Taylor, former liaison to John Travolta; and former Scientologists Tom DeVocht, Sara Goldberg, and Hana Eltringham Whitfield.
